BALTIC SEA (May 9, 2019) Fire Controlman 1st Class David Nunez cleans the barrel of a close-in weapons system during a fresh water wash down aboard the guided-missile destroyer USS Gravely (DDG 107). Gravely is underway on a regularly-scheduled deployment as the flagship of Standing NATO Maritime Group 1 to conduct maritime operations and provide a continuous maritime capability for NATO in the northern Atlantic.
